The sales slip and hang tag for my [used] bass say it's a BB 405, but I'm becoming more convinced that it's really a BB G5, which, as far as I can tell so far, is the same "woodwork" as a BB 405 but has entirely different PUs and electronics, thus the other review specifying [titled] "Yamaha BB405 4-knob". Originally, I'd thought that mine was an earlier version, that current 405's were "economized" versions of the older, but now I think mine is really a BB G5.
